Product Description
MAHLE 41909.02 (.020 over) complete piston ring set for the 2001–2010 GM 6.6L Duramax (LB7/LLY/LBZ/LMM). Rings are pre-lapped for immediate seating and built to OE specs for reliable sealing and long service life. Top ring is ductile iron with plasma-moly face; second ring is cast iron; oil ring assembly is GNS. Sold as a complete engine set.
- Bore: ~4.075 in (4.0748 in)
- Oversize: .020 in
- Construction: Ductile-iron moly top, cast-iron second, GNS oil ring
- GTIN/UPC: 027067460806
- MPN variants seen: 41909.02 / 41909.020 / 41909020
Fitment
- 2001–2010 Chevrolet Silverado 2500HD/3500HD • GMC Sierra 2500HD/3500HD
- 2003–2009 Chevrolet Kodiak 4500/5500 • GMC TopKick 4500/5500
- 2006–2010 Chevrolet Express 2500/3500 • GMC Savana 2500/3500 (6.6L)
- 2006 Hummer H1 Alpha 6.6L Duramax
- Engine RPO codes: LB7, LLY, LBZ, LMM (VIN codes 1, 2, 6, D)

What’s Included
Complete engine set of piston rings for all eight cylinders (file-fit as required). Pistons not included.
Install Notes
Verify bore size, piston-to-wall clearance, and end-gaps. Follow MAHLE specifications for ring orientation and gaps. Hone finish should match ring material and intended use.
